Dhoni Fined for Traffic Law Violation
Former India captain Mahendra Singh Dhoni has been fined ₹1,000 in Ranchi for overspeeding. An e-challan was issued under Section 183 of the Motor Vehicles Act after the city’s automatic traffic monitoring system detected his vehicle exceeding the speed limit.
The minor traffic violation quickly drew attention on social media. Earlier, Dhoni had also made headlines when the Jharkhand State Housing Board served him a notice over allegations of using a residential plot for commercial purposes. Officials had expressed concern that the plot, originally allotted for residential use, might have been used for commercial activities.
Meanwhile, ahead of the IPL 2026 season, Dhoni has already begun net sessions with Chennai Super Kings. The five-time champions are preparing for a fresh start following a disappointing 2025 campaign.
